Welcome to the Season of Easter…

We have passed through Lent, Holy Week, the Great Three Days (the Triduum), and have entered the Season of Easter. How wonderful is the event of the Resurrection of Jesus the Christ that we need an entire liturgical season to celebrate this gift from God. Each of the Sundays of Easter has a focus on the life and ministry of Jesus (Easter Day, Thomas Sunday, Meal Sunday, Good Shepherd Sunday, I AM Sunday, and Ascension Sunday). Ancient Monasticism began with the Desert Fathers and Mothers. People would often approach them and make the request, “give me a word.” Part of the adaptation of this ancient tradition during the first week of the Season of Easter is to give special focus to “a word” each day:

Easter Day: Resurrection Monday: New Life Tuesday: Victory

Wednesday: Embodiment Thursday: Power

Friday: Empty Tomb Saturday: Follow

First Sunday after Easter Day: Conversion

Dietrich Bonhoeffer (1906-1945)

Dietrich Bonhoeffer grew up in a home that valued education. He earned a doctorate in theology in 1927 from the University of Berlin at the age of twenty-one. He also studied at Union Theological Seminary in New York City from 1930-1931. As the Nazi party was gaining notoriety and power in Germany, many of Bonhoeffer’s friends urged him to stay in the United States rather than return to Germany, but he opted to go home. Upon his return to Germany, Bonhoeffer accepted a position as lecturer in systematic theology at the University of Berlin. He also began teaching confirmation classes for adolescent males in a Berlin slum. When Adolf Hitler came to power in 1933, Bonhoeffer became a leading spokesman about Hitler’s dictatorship and spoke out against his program of genocide and the Jewish Holocaust. Bonhoeffer helped organize an underground seminary. He authored a book entitled, The Cost of Discipleship, which is still in print and used today in many theological circles. In 1939, Bonhoeffer, through his brother-in-law, became aware of the existence of a group whose intent was to overthrow Hitler. Because of his knowledge of this group and this affiliate connection, in April 1943, just after becoming engaged to be married, Bonhoeffer was arrested and imprisoned. Later he was moved to a concentration camp at Flossenburg. On April 9, 1945, just days before the American army would liberate Flossenburg, Dietrich Bonhoeffer was hanged at the age of thirty-one. His family would not learn of it for months. The July before he had written to his trusted friend (and later biographer), Eberhard Bethge, one day after the failed assassination attempt on Hitler’s life: “May God lead us kindly through these times, but above all, may God lead us to himself.” Dietrich Bonhoeffer was a theologian, poet, author, and pastor. His passion for living out his faith fueled his discipleship and ministry and ultimately cost him his life. Through his prolific writings, he continues to serve as a prophetic and inspiring voice for the Church universal. The last words of Dietrich Bonhoeffer before his hanging are appropriate for this celebration of the close of the Lenten season and the opening of the Easter Season: “This is the end – for me the beginning of life.”

Fools for Christ April Fools’ Day isn’t a religious holiday, though it may date to Pope Gregory XIII and his new calendar. In 1582, he shifted New Year’s Day from April to January, and people who didn’t believe the change were called April fools. April Fools’ Day may also be connected to the lightheartedness that comes with warmer weather, as well as to medieval Christian festivals that involved pranks, disguises and a temporarily inverted social order. Yet, in Scripture, such reversal characterizes the kingdom of God. In 1 Corinthians 1:18-25, St. Paul writes that the gospel seems foolish to people who don’t know Christ, that God uses the “foolishness of our proclamation” to offer salvation to all and that God’s foolishness is wiser than human wisdom. Jesus “foolishly” inverted the social order, saying the last will be first and the first, last. So if on April 1 — and every day — we live as “fools for Christ,” we’re precisely what he calls us to be!
